The rate of photosynthesis can be measured by monitoring the production of oxygen or the consumption of carbon dioxide, which are the products and reactants of the process, respectively. By measuring the amount of oxygen released or carbon dioxide taken in over a given time, the rate of photosynthesis can be determined. Similarly, the rate of cellular respiration can be measured by monitoring the consumption of oxygen or the production of carbon dioxide, which are the reactants and products of the process, respectively.
